Programme Overview

The Executive Development Programme in Applied Math for Scientific Computing and Simulation is designed for senior-level professionals and executives from various industries who seek to enhance their understanding of advanced mathematical techniques and their applications in scientific computing and simulation. This programme equips participants with the latest methodologies and tools to solve complex problems, optimize processes, and drive innovation in their respective fields.

Learners will develop a comprehensive set of skills, including proficiency in numerical analysis, statistical modeling, and computational techniques. They will gain expertise in utilizing high-performance computing resources and advanced software tools for simulation and data analysis. Additionally, participants will learn to apply mathematical models to real-world scenarios, interpret complex data sets, and leverage simulation technologies to predict outcomes and inform strategic decision-making. The programme also emphasizes the integration of mathematical principles with industry-specific applications, ensuring that learners can effectively apply their knowledge to enhance business performance and competitiveness.

Topics Covered

  1. Foundational Concepts: Covers the core principles and key terminology.: Numerical Linear Algebra: Explores methods for solving systems of linear equations.
  2. Optimization Techniques: Discusses algorithms for finding optimal solutions.: Differential Equations: Analyzes methods for solving ordinary and partial differential equations.
  3. Data Analysis: Introduces statistical methods and data visualization techniques.: High-Performance Computing: Focuses on parallel and distributed computing for simulations.
